In recent years, the conversation around purchasing cannabis online in North Carolina, particularly in Brunswick County, has become increasingly nuanced. As more states across the US embrace the legalization of cannabis, residents and policymakers in North Carolina are exploring various perspectives on this emerging market.

On one hand, proponents argue that buying cannabis online offers a convenient and discreet option for consumers who may not have easy access to physical dispensaries. This is especially relevant in areas like Brunswick County, where local options might be limited. Online platforms provide a wider selection of products, including innovative offerings like THCa Locally, which can appeal to both recreational users and those seeking therapeutic benefits.

Conversely, some community members express concerns about the potential risks associated with online cannabis sales. These include issues related to product quality assurance and age verification processes. Without stringent regulations and oversight, there is a fear that minors could gain access to these products or that consumers might receive subpar or mislabeled items.

Additionally, there’s an ongoing debate about how online cannabis sales impact local businesses and economies. While some argue that it undermines brick-and-mortar dispensaries by diverting potential customers away from local shops, others believe it could stimulate economic growth by creating new business opportunities within the digital space.
